NIFTYLIFT is celebrating after winning the Hire Industry Supplier of the Year accolade for the second consecutive year, and seventh time overall, at the 2025 Hire Awards of Excellence, hosted by the Hire Association Europe (HAE).
The award recognises companies that can demonstrate effective R&D of industry-leading products and services and a sustainable, commercially successful approach to the supplying of stock, equipment or services to the plant, tool, equipment and event hire sectors.
Judges consider the use of effective training programmes that provide benefits to the business, employees and customers, evidence of reduced numbers of complaints, and the active development of employees through their adoption of company values and procedures and the provision of stimulating and supportive workplaces.

Launched last year, adding to the company’s portfolio of compact, low-weight articulating booms, the all-electric HR22SE is already attracting accolades for Niftylift. In March, it was named Product of the Year – Self Propelled Booms & Atrium Lifts at the 2025 International Awards for Powered Access (IAPAs). It has also been shortlisted for Rental Product of the Year at the 2025 European Rental Awards.
